Pros

I enjoyed my time here. Good work-life balance, nice people, easy gig for the pay. The marketing org always felt disorganized, but that didn't bother me too much.

Cons

Hundreds of people lost their jobs right before the holiday season. It's hard to imagine that this absolutely could not have waited until the new year. I hope both former and current employees take this as a reminder: Don't give too much of your emotional energy or time to your job. Even nice companies in Corporate America ultimately do not care about you.
